Yorkies require regular physical and mental stimulation to keep their health and vitality. Yorkies are fun and have a big-hearted attitude that can appear feisty or assertive. Their intelligence is also a reason they learn quickly and are bored easily if they aren't given enough stimulation.

It is essential to keep up with your puppy's veterinary examinations. This will ensure that your yorkie is receiving all the vaccinations required and other medical care needed to remain healthy. It will also assist in helping establish relationships with your veterinarian, which could be vital in the future if you ever need to seek veterinary advice or assistance for a medical condition.

Yorkies have a fast metabolism, so they need to eat small meals throughout the day. This will help keep their energy levels high and stop them from becoming too hungry. Also, they should only eat foods that are specifically formulated to suit their weight. This will help them avoid gastrointestinal issues.

A Yorkie that is well socialized will be friendly to all ages of people. This is especially crucial during the crucial socialization time between 3 and 14 weeks of age. They'll be less likely to develop aggression or fear towards strangers when they become adults. Socialization can help them adapt to different environments and household noises, such as vacuum cleaners, mini biewer Yorkshire terrier kaufen​ doorbells, and kitchen appliances. You should also help them acclimatize them to being treated with respect, including grooming and having their ears checked.

You can also socialize your Yorkie by taking them out to other dogs under your supervision. This will teach your Yorkie to interact with dogs and prevent them from becoming territorial or aggressive. Introduce new dogs to your Yorkie only in a secure, controlled environment. A dog park or pet-friendly store are good alternatives.
